Arshdeep Singh becomes India’s leading wicket-taker in T20Is
The left-arm fast bowler, outclassed Yuzvendra Chahal to become India’s leading wicket-taker in T20 Internationals, achieving this milestone in his 61st match for India by taking his tally to 97 wickets. This achievement came during a crucial power play when Arshdeep dismissed Phil Salt with a strong bounce in the first over and followed up with the wicket of Ben Duckett in the third over, effectively setting England back early in the game.
With this performance, Arshdeep not only broke Chahal’s record of 96 wickets but also showed his form and potential, aiming to become one of the fastest to reach 100 T20I wickets globally.

Arshdeep jokingly apologizes to Yuzvendra Chahal
After the match, Arshdeep spoke about his performance and how the Indian team performed. Arshdeep expressed his happiness and gratitude, acknowledging that his hard work finally paid off. He shared his determination to maintain his form and continue to contribute to the team’s success by taking crucial wickets for the country, highlighting his commitment to perform at his best on the international stage.
“It feels great, I’m grateful my hard work has paid off and I’ll try to keep taking wickets for the country.” Arshdeep said in a video shared by BCCI on Instagram.
Before wrapping up, Arshdeep showed a light-hearted moment of camaraderie and humor by jokingly apologizing to Chahal for getting over him. With a smile, he said ‘Yuzi Bhai’ and touched his ears, imitating an apologetic gesture in a funny and endearing way.
